CSU Bakersfield Roadrunners (0-3) at San Diego State Aztecs (2-1)
San Diego; Saturday, 4 p.m. EST
BOTTOM LINE: San Diego State takes on CSU Bakersfield after Kennedy Lee scored 24 points in San Diego State's 91-70 victory against the CSU Northridge Matadors.
San Diego State finished 25-10 overall with a 10-5 record at home during the 2024-25 season. The Aztecs averaged 68.8 points per game last season, 12.6 on free throws and 15.6 from deep.
CSU Bakersfield went 2-18 in Big West action and 1-15 on the road a season ago. The Roadrunners averaged 8.9 assists per game on 18.2 made field goals last season.
